A strong Industrial Safety Engineer resume leads with a focused professional summary that names the exact role and your standout achievement. In the experience section, open every bullet with a strong action verb and quantify the result with numbers wherever possible. Highlight your most relevant competencies — especially Industrial Safety, As an Industrial Safety, and Lean Manufacturing & Six Sigma — in a dedicated Skills section positioned early so ATS systems and hiring managers both find it immediately.

For format, most Industrial Safety Engineer roles suit a reverse-chronological layout: most recent position first, working backwards. Keep to one page for under five years of experience, or two pages for senior candidates with a rich project or leadership history. Use clean, ATS-safe fonts (10–12pt), standard section headings (Summary, Experience, Education, Skills), and avoid tables, text boxes, or multi-column layouts that applicant tracking systems cannot parse reliably.

What is the best resume format for Industrial Engineering professionals?

A reverse-chronological format is the standard choice for most Industrial Engineering candidates — employers expect to see your most recent role first, working backwards. If you are transitioning into Industrial Engineering from a related field, a hybrid format (brief skills summary at the top followed by chronological experience) can bridge the gap effectively. Keep the document to one page for under five years of experience, or two pages for senior specialists.

How do I make my Industrial Engineering resume pass applicant tracking systems (ATS)?

Use standard section headings — Summary, Experience, Education, Skills — rather than creative labels that ATS parsers do not recognise. Embed domain keywords such as "Lean Manufacturing & Six Sigma" and "Process Mapping & Value Stream Analysis" naturally inside your experience bullets rather than cramming them into a standalone keyword list. Avoid tables, multi-column layouts, text boxes, headers, footers, and images — these confuse most modern parsers and can cause your resume to be misread or rejected before a human sees it.

What mistakes do Industrial Engineering professionals most commonly make on their resume?

The most frequent issue is not listing Six Sigma certification level — employers explicitly filter by belt level. Beyond that, generic objective statements, unquantified achievements, and inconsistent date formatting appear across almost every Industrial Engineering application. Fix these by replacing every vague claim with a measurable outcome — specific numbers and named projects add credibility that adjectives cannot.
